ESCANABA — The large cast of 36 actors for Players de Noc’s musical Gypsy includes nine elementary school students as it follows the life of Gypsy Rose Lee from childhood to burlesque performer.
It’s a musical that director Lynn Soderberg has long wanted to do.
The well-know song the performers sing as they grow up is “Let Me Entertain You.”
“So, we have two young girls who are 10 and 12 who play baby June and baby Louise when they are young kids and then we have girls who play them when they are older. Everybody gets to sing, ‘Let Me Entertain You’ except me. I don’t get to sing that,” said Soderberg.
That’s because Soderberg also plays the girls’ mother, Momma Rose. It’s a part she has looked forward to.
“Momma Rose is a dream role for any actress. You get to a certain age and there are certain roles that you hope that you may sometime get to play once in your lifetime. Momma Rose was one of those roles for me,” Soderberg said.
Soderberg says she is pleased the way the musical has turned out.
